The Risks of Delaying Emergency Roof Repairs

Roof damage rarely fixes itself. In fact, every hour that passes without attention increases the risk of further issues. Here’s what can happen if emergency repairs are delayed:

1. Water Damage and Structural Compromise

Even a small leak can allow water to seep into your home. Over time, this can lead to stained ceilings, rotting timber, damaged insulation, and even structural weakening of your roof or walls.

2. Mould and Damp Problems

Persistent moisture creates the perfect conditions for mould and damp to develop. Not only is this harmful to your property, but it can also pose health risks for occupants, particularly those with allergies or respiratory conditions.

3. Escalating Repair Costs

A minor repair that could have been resolved in hours may turn into a major project if ignored. Emergency repairs carried out promptly can prevent extensive water damage, saving homeowners thousands in restoration costs.

4. Safety Hazards

Loose or missing tiles, damaged flashing, and unstable structures can all pose risks to people and property. High winds or storms can worsen the situation, increasing the likelihood of falling debris.

Common Causes of Emergency Roof Repairs

Roofs in the UK face a variety of challenges due to our changing weather conditions. Some of the most common triggers for emergency repairs include:

  • Storm damage from high winds or heavy rainfall
  • Slipped or missing tiles exposing the underlayment
  • Leaking lead flashing around chimneys and roof valleys
  • Fallen branches or debris after strong winds
  • Sudden roof leaks caused by blocked gutters or drainage problems

Identifying the root cause quickly is key to carrying out effective, long-lasting repairs.

How to Minimise Future Emergency Situations

While not all emergencies can be avoided, preventative maintenance significantly reduces the risk of sudden roof problems. Scheduling regular inspections, clearing gutters, and addressing minor issues before they escalate will help keep your roof in excellent condition year-round.
